The 2010 season was Jeju United FC's twenty-eighth season in the K-League in South Korea. Jeju United FC is competing in K-League, League Cup and Korean FA Cup.

The 2010 K League Championship was the 14th competition of the K League Championship, and was held to decide the 28th champions of the K League. The top six clubs of the regular season qualified for the championship. The winners of the regular season directly qualified for the final, and second place team qualified for the semi-final. The other four clubs entered the first round, and the winners of the second round advanced to the semi-final. Each match was played as a single match, excluding the final which consisted of two matches.
